2. Front Seat
A: REMOVAL
1) Disconnect the ground cable from battery, and
wait for more than 20 seconds before starting work.
CAUTION:
The airbag system is fitted with a backup power
source. After disconnecting the battery ground
cable, the airbag may deploy if you do not wait
for 20 seconds before starting the repair of air-
bag system.
2) While pressing the headrest lock button, remove
the headrest.
3) Tilt the backrest forward.
4) Move the seat to full front end.
5) Remove the bolt cover at the rear side of slide
rail.
6) Remove the two bolts at the rear side of slide
rail.
7) Move the seat to full rear end.
Front Seat
8) Remove the two bolts at the front side of slide
rail.
9) Disconnect the connector under the seat.
• Seat belt warning light connector
• Side airbag connector (model with side airbag)
• Seat heater connector (model with seat heater)
SE-00003
10) Remove the front seat from vehicle.
B: INSTALLATION
Install in the reverse order of removal.
Tightening torque:
Refer to "COMPONENT" of "General Descrip-
tion". <Ref. to SE-2, FRONT SEAT (STAN-
DARD SEAT), COMPONENT, General
Description.>
C: DISASSEMBLY
SE-00048
1. STANDARD SEAT
1) Remove the seat from vehicle. <Ref. to SE-7,
REMOVAL, Front Seat.>
2) Remove the seat lifter cover using a flat tip
screwdriver and loosen the inner bolt to remove
seat lifter lever.
